REEL DEL: The Croods REVIEW

Its time for a prehistoric fun time with Dreamworks newest animation offering for 2013, The Croods.

This is the story of the prehistoric family of the Croods, which includes Eep (Emma Stone), a girl in a family of cavemen living in pre-historic times, talking about how her family is one of the few to survive nearby, mainly due to the strict rules of her father, Grug (Nicolas Cage) and his wife Ugga (Catherine Keener), daughter Sandy, son Thunk (Clark Duke), and his mother-in-law (Cloris Leachman), which were used in living in a cave all of their lives but when seismic events destroys their home, they now embark on a journey of finding a new home.

They would also encounter a new guy named Guy (Ryan Reynolds) and his pet Belt. The movie comes in 3D and is actually a visual feast . I also liked the Owl City track featured in the movie. Kids will definitely love this movie because of the humor and also values which they can learn from the characters.

Show summary in 3 lines: Evolve or History
Technical Effects: 4 out of 5 stars (Its unusual for me to like the first part because my visual standards would adjust to eventually appreciate it, but here I loved it from start to finish)
Plot: 3 out of 5 stars (Family adventure and meeting new characters is a common plot but has a nice twist)
Acting and Actors: 4 out of 5 stars  (Emma Stone is a cute caveteenager!) 
Music and Soundtracks:  4 out for 5 stars (A very good soundtrack line up for an animation film)
DVD Worthiness: YAY! (hope it includes a "Belt")
Pros:  Characters, 3D effects, Landscapes, Lines
Cons:  Plot, Dark scenes
Overall Rating: 3.9 out of 5 stars (Cute kid and family movie, actually anyone will be very entertained, I would say that the comedy is really great!)
